Scale representation of the USS Indianapolis

The USS Indianapolis was a heavy cruiser of the U.S. Navy commissioned in 1932 and active across major Pacific engagements in World War II. This Tamiya 1/700 kit depicts the ship as she appeared in July 1945, providing a compact but detailed subject for display.

Historical background and mission highlights

Noted for serving as a flagship and for transporting vital wartime material, Indianapolis held an important operational role. The model mirrors these historical aspects through its external fittings and deck layout accuracy.

Detailing, parts and finished size

Tamiya's moulding reproduces the ship's superstructure, gun arrangements and deck fittings with fine detail. The kit features anti-aircraft guns, rotating turrets and deck textures such as anchor chain and non-slip patterns. At 1/700 scale the completed hull is approximately 266mm long and 29mm wide.

Specifications

  • Scale: 1/700
  • Length: 266mm
  • Width: 29mm
  • Material: Plastic
  • Includes two Curtiss SC-1 Seahawks
The finished model measures about 266mm long and 29mm wide at 1/700 scale, making it a compact display piece that works well on a ship base or within a small diorama.
